Readings

First: I Kings 19:9, 11-13 - Elijah experiences God's power on the mountain, through wind, earthquake, fire and gentle breeze.

Psalm 84 - Let us see O Lord, your mercy and give us your saving help / I will hear what the Lord God has to say / Mercy and faithfulness have met / The Lord will make us prosper.

Second: Romans 9: 1-5 - I would willingly be condemned and cut off from Christ if it could help by brothers of Israel ... from them came Christ who is above all, God forever blessed.

Gospel: Matthew  14: 22-33 - Jesus walks on the water.


Themes

Hearing the voice of God.  Jesus as the mediator of God's safety.  Trust in God.   Peace.   The calm after the storm.
